フェールセーフ

更新日:2024年11月01日

フェールセーフの定義と意義

「フェールセーフ」という概念は、システムの設計と運用において極めて重要です。想定外の障害が発生した際に、その影響を最小限に抑えるためのメカニズムを指します。特にビジネスや経営情報システムで高い信頼性が求められる環境では、フェールセーフは欠かせない要素です。このコンセプトは「障害が発生しても安全を確保する」ことを目的としており、システム全体が無秩序に停止するのを防ぎ、人命やデータ、インフラに対する重大な影響を回避します。フェールセーフは「故障モードとその影響の分析(FMEA)」や「障害木解析(FTA)」といった手法と密接に関連しており、これによりシステム内の各要素が故障した場合の影響を予測し、対策を講じます。具体的な例として、自動車産業では、センサーやコンピュータ制御を通じてブレーキシステムの障害を検出し、安全な状態を保つ処置が施されます。また、航空産業では複数のシステムが冗長性を持ち、例えばエンジンが一つ停止しても飛行可能な設計が採用されており、ITシステムではサーバーのクラスタリングで障害時に役割を引き継ぎます。

フェールセーフの応用と実践

ビジネスシステムでは、データの消失を防ぐためにバックアップシステムが不可欠であり、オンサイトとオフサイトの両方でバックアップが推奨されます。システム全体をリアルタイムで監視し、異常が見られた際に迅速に対応するためのモニタリングシステムも重要です。さらに、重要なシステムにはハードウェアやソフトウェアの冗長化が行われ、例えばクラウドベースのシステムではデータが複数の地理的に離れたロケーションに保存されるため、特定地域で障害が発生してもサービスを継続できます。また、セキュリティ対策もフェールセーフの一環であり、侵入検知システムやファイアウォール、データ暗号化などの技術を用いて外部からの攻撃や内部の不正行為を防ぐことが求められます。これにより、万が一セキュリティ侵害が発生した場合でも迅速に対応できるようになります。企業はフェールセーフの導入によって、システムの信頼性と安全性を向上させることが可能となり、より安定した運用が実現します。

フェールセーフの限界と今後の課題

フェールセーフ設計には多大なコストがかかるため、全てのシステムやプロセスに適用することは現実的ではない場合があります。追加のハードウェアやソフトウェア、人的リソースが必要となり、コストと効果のバランスをどう取るかが課題です。また、フェールセーフそのものが完全に障害を防ぐわけではなく、予期せぬ事態に対応しきれないこともあります。フェールセーフはリスクを最小限に抑えるための手段であり、絶対的な安全を保証するものではありません。ユーザーがシステムが完全に安全であると誤解しないよう、ユーザートレーニングや定期的なシステムの評価とメンテナンスを行うことが重要です。フェールセーフはビジネスや経営情報システムの運用において欠かせない要素ですが、導入と運用にはリソースが必要であり、経費対効果を慎重に評価することが求められます。フェールセーフは万能ではないため、他のリスク管理手法と組み合わせることで、より堅牢なシステム運用が可能になります。専門家の意見や最新技術の導入、そして継続的な改善が重要であり、フェールセーフの概念とその応用は、現代の高度情報化社会においてますます重要性が増しています。